Frequently asked questions
1. What is a Vietnam e-visa?
The Vietnam e-visa is an electronic visa that allows foreigners to enter Vietnam without needing to submit paper applications at an Embassy or Consulate. The visa application is processed and issued through an online system.

3. What documents are required to apply for an e-visa?
To apply for an e-visa, you need a scanned copy or photo of your passport (the page with your photo and personal information), a passport-sized photo (4x6 cm) with a white background, and a credit card to pay the fee.
According to Vietnam Law, the visa expiry date must be at least 30 days before the passport expiry date. Therefore, an E-visa expiry date must also be at least 30 days before the passport expiry date.
4. How long does it take to process the e-visa?
An E-visa Vietnam is processed within 4-6 working days after the Vietnam Immigration Department receives the completed application and full E-visa fee.

5. Can the e-visa be extended?
The e-visa cannot be directly extended. If you wish to stay longer, you will need to contact Vietnam's immigration authority or exit and apply for a new visa.
6. What can I do if my e-visa application is denied?
If your e-visa application is denied, you may need to reapply with correct information and documents or consider applying for a visa through the nearest Vietnamese Embassy or Consulate.
